本章节会介绍如何开启分布式事务 操作背景 分布式事务指事务的参与者、支持事务的服务器、资源服务器以及事务管理器分别位于不同的分布式系统的不同节点之上。简单的说,就是一次大的操作由不同的小操作组成,这些小的操作分布在不同的服务器上,且属于不同的应用,分布式事务需要保证这些小操作要么全部成功,要么全部失败。本质上来说,分布式事务就是为了保证不同数据库的数据一致性。
相比于传统的集中式数据库,分布式数据被分散存储在多个物理位置(多台服务器或数据中心)上,并将这些分散的存储资源构成一个虚拟的存储设备。这种存储方式不仅实现在线扩容能力,同时也提升了数据的检索能力。而且分布式数据库利用SQL语言进行分布式查询和处理,使其性能和扩展性得到显著提升。 分布式数据存储原理 分布式存储架构通常由三个部分组成:客户端、元数据服务器(协调节点)和数据服务器(数据节点)。其主要流程是:客户端负责发送读写请求,缓存文件元数据和文件数据。
本节主要介绍设置分布式会话 传统单实例应用使用本地会话管理,用户请求产生的会话上下文都被存于进程内存中。在加入负载均衡模块后,多实例的会话需要使用分布式存储进行共享。 ServiceStage提供开箱即用的分布式会话功能,使用分布式缓存服务作为会话持久化层,无需代码更改,即可赋予Tomcat应用,使用express-session的Node.js应用以及使用session handle的PHP应用分布式会话管理能力。 在部署组件过程中,可以在数据库设置中绑定分布式会话,操作步骤如下。
本节主要介绍分布式缓存服务Redis的管理与使用概述 管理分布式缓存服务Redis实例 天翼云分布式缓存服务Redis版提供两种方式进行实例管理,分别为Web可视化控制台与OpenAPI。 Web可视化管理控制台 登录天翼云账号后,进入控制中心,选择开通实例的资源池,选择”分布式缓存服务Redis“即可进入Redis控制台。控制台提供Redis相关实例管理能力,包括实例生命周期管理、实例详情信息、实例配置管理、实例备份恢复管理等,具体操作请查看本章用户指南中的各子章节。
容量型:对于普通共享文件的客户,文件存储采用普通HDD存储池,提供容量型弹性文件服务,接入部分由文件管理服务静态负载均衡+可扩展文件网关服务组成,使用浮动IP对外提供高可用的存储服务,底层基于分布式文件存储集群提供数据读写。 性能型:对于性能要求较高的客户,文件存储采用SSD全闪存储池,提供性能型弹性文件服务,接入部分由文件管理服务静态负载均衡+可扩展文件网关服务组成,使用浮动IP对外提供高可用的存储服务,底层基于分布式文件存储集群提供数据读写。
一、云存储服务全球分布式部署的概念 云存储服务是一种基于云计算技术的数据存储解决方案,它将大量的数据存储资源集中在云端,并通过网络向用户提供数据存储、访问和管理等服务。而全球分布式部署则是指云存储服务在全球范围内设置多个数据中心,通过高速网络连接,实现数据的全球分布存储和访问。 全球分布式部署的核心理念是将数据分散存储在全球各地的数据中心,以充分利用各地的网络资源和存储资源,提高数据的访问速度和可靠性。
一、云存储服务全球分布式部署的概念 云存储服务是一种基于云计算技术的数据存储解决方案,它将大量的数据存储资源集中在云端,并通过网络向用户提供数据存储、访问和管理等服务。而全球分布式部署则是指云存储服务在全球范围内设置多个数据中心,通过高速网络连接,实现数据的全球分布存储和访问。 全球分布式部署的核心理念是将数据分散存储在全球各地的数据中心,以充分利用各地的网络资源和存储资源,提高数据的访问速度和可靠性。
二、Ceph的优势 可靠性高:Ceph采用了多副本和分布式一致性协议,确保数据在多个节点上同时存储和备份,避免了单点故障的发生。 可扩展性强:Ceph具有良好的可扩展性,可以在多台服务器上部署,并根据数据规模和性能需求进行线性扩展。 高性能:Ceph采用了优化的数据分布算法和数据管理机制,使得它具有高性能的读写能力,可以满足各种应用的需求。 安全性高:Ceph提供了数据加密、访问控制和安全审计等功能,确保数据的安全性和隐私性。
兼容性强:HBlock适用于市面上通用的标准化服务器,覆盖常见的Linux操作系统,在一个分布式集群中可以包含不同架构的服务器,CPU和内存配置也可以各不相同,真正实现一云多芯。在一云多芯的基础上,HBlock还实现了“同云异盘”,即支持集群中各硬盘容量不同,从而盘活任何规格的、具有存储潜力的硬件。 采用分布式多控制器技术:HBlock支持多节点同时读写,避免单点瓶颈的问题,具备集中式软件低时延特性,并且宏观上通过分布式提供扩展性,微观上对每个卷具备多控能力,以提高系统可用性。
(不影响其他分布式消息服务的订购和使用) 2、存量客户:如您未对分布式消息服务进行迁移,也没有主动删除分布式消息服务下“队列管理”中的消息队列,消息队列将于2022年6月15日冻结直至删除,存在数据丢失风险。我们强烈建议您: 1)如您继续使用分布式消息服务,可将分布式消息服务迁移至天翼云体验更佳的分布式消息服务产品Kafka专享版、RabbitMQ专享版,天翼云运维团队将全程配合您完成业务迁移,确保业务正常稳定运行。
HBlock基于MPIO的“一主多备”方案,故障场景下支持数据链路自动切换,集群中所有服务都采用冗余模式部署,数据处理过程不依赖任何时钟服务器,使用天翼云自研的分布式租约和心跳机制进行主备切换,从发生故障到故障发现,再到完成服务接管,整个过程几秒内就能完成。在切换过程中,分布式多控制器保证了两个缓存之间的数据是强一致的,确保数据不丢失。
分布式融合数据库解决方案 播放视频 TeleDB for HTAP 融合型云原生分布式数据库是一种将事务处理(Transactional Processing)和分析处理(Analytical Processing)能力融合于同一数据库系统中的解决方案。